AFP: The United States is considering dusting off and toughening a year-old offer for Iran to transfer uranium to Russia for further enrichment, a leading French newspaper reported Thursday.

Wall Street Journal: Iranian authorities are taking extraordinary security measures ahead of cuts to energy and food subsidies this month, in an effort to prevent unrest by a public upset about rising expenses and inflation.

Bloomberg: BP Plc said production at its North Sea Rhum natural-gas field will halt next week to ensure compliance with European Union sanctions against Iran.

Bloomberg: Transocean Ltd., the world’s largest offshore oil driller, said it may have violated U.S. sanctions when goods bound for a company-owned rig in Turkmenistan traveled through Iran.
